Rockwell Collins.


Rockwell Collins has received a contract from Boeing to provide the display for the B-1B Threat Situation Awareness System (TSAS) upgrade. Rockwell is to supply a six-inch Multi-Function Display capable of imaging high-resolution images of flight information such as altitude and heading. The display system will enable in-flight mission planning and support Link-16 connectivity. Further contract details were not released.
